Missing Link Swimmer Statue (Gone)
Wall Township, New Jersey
There are limitations to chainsaw art, but whoever carved this swimmer seems to have been channeling an inner Bigfoot sculptor. Any human being with this physique would be breaking cinder blocks with his head, not smoothly sliding through water. The arms appear to have been grafted from a gorilla.
And yet the creator of this beefy throwback has had the last laugh. When Superstorm Sandy walloped this part of the Jersey Shore in 2012, entire buildings collapsed -- but the Missing Link Swimmer Statue snarled face-first into the hurricane and survived, apparently no worse for wear.
